UPMC fundraiser set for Aug. 4


GREENVILLE, Pa. — UPMC Horizon employees will have the second annual motorcycle poker run to benefit the UPMC Horizon Community Health Foundation. The run will be from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Aug. 4. Tickets are $20 for riders and $15 for passengers.

Ticket price includes a box lunch at the first stop and a buffet dinner at 1866 Restaurant and Taproom in Mercer. Registration will be from 10 to 11 a.m. at UPMC Horizon, Greenville, in the upper parking lot.

Riders will go to UPMC Northwest, 100 Fairfield Drive, Seneca, from 12:15 to 1 p.m. They will meet at 2:30 p.m. in My Brother’s Place. 2058 Leesburg-Grove City Road and end at 4 p.m. at the 1866 Restaurant and Taproom.
